How do darknet marketplaces differ from regular online marketplaces?
Darknet marketplaces operate on encrypted networks like Tor and I2P, which make them less accessible than regular websites. These platforms mostly allow for anonymous transactions and commonly accept payments in cryptocurrencies such as Bitcoin and Monero. Unlike mainstream sites, they often have stricter privacy measures, utilize escrow services, and typically feature a wider range of prohibited items. Security concerns, trust issues, and the need for anonymity are far more pronounced compared to conventional online shopping.

Which cryptocurrencies are most frequently supported on these sites, and why?
Bitcoin is the most commonly accepted cryptocurrency on darknet marketplaces due to its widespread adoption and recognition. However, privacy-focused currencies like Monero have gained popularity, as they offer stronger anonymity features. Some markets also accept Litecoin or Zcash. The focus on cryptocurrency stems from the need for financial privacy and the difficulty of tracing transactions on these networks.

How do reputation systems work on darknet marketplaces?
Reputation systems on darknet marketplaces function similarly to feedback systems on well-known e-commerce platforms. Buyers and sellers leave ratings and reviews following transactions. Higher-rated vendors usually gain more trust and more sales, while poor ratings can drive a vendor away. Some platforms enforce vendor bonds (deposits) and display detailed transaction histories to help users make informed decisions before engaging in a deal.
